Go to the Texas State Library's homepage at www.tsl.state.tx.us to see a new resource for genealogy searchers with deep Texas roots. The Adjutant General Service Records are now on the web, available for searching. This is a "searchable database (that) combines both official service records from the Adjutant General's Office and alphabetic files created by other agencies relating to military service." Included are Texas Rangers, the Army of the Republic of Texas, and other less well-known groups. The documents have been scanned, and can be printed out. Contact me if you need help with this.
